Security and Privacy in UK Mobile Computing

Understanding the landscape and safeguards

The rise of smartphones has sparked significant cybersecurity challenges in the UK, where mobile devices are integral to daily life. With increasing data transmission over networks, threats like malware, phishing, and spoofing target these platforms aggressively. The emphasis on smartphone security UK reflects a growing need to protect sensitive information on these easily accessible devices.

UK regulations, including the Data Protection Act 2018 and adherence to GDPR, set the framework for managing privacy and data security. These laws mandate strict controls on data handling, imposing penalties for breaches that compromise mobile user information. Compliance with these standards helps enterprises reduce risks and enhance consumer trust.

Individuals can adopt practical steps to safeguard their devices: frequently updating operating systems, enabling strong authentication methods, and avoiding unsecured public Wi-Fi connections. Enterprises must also enforce mobile device management policies, conduct regular security audits, and educate employees on emerging mobile threats.

Prioritizing privacy and cybersecurity in mobile computing is essential to counter evolving threats. Awareness, adherence to UK regulations, and proactive security practices collectively reinforce protections for all smartphone users.

Accessibility and Digital Inclusion Advancements

Smartphones have become pivotal in promoting accessibility and digital inclusion within the UK digital society. Their widespread adoption offers a practical bridge across the digital divide, especially for individuals facing mobility, vision, or hearing challenges. Modern devices come equipped with built-in features such as voice control, screen readers, and customizable display options. These tools directly address the needs of diverse user groups, making technology more approachable and functional.

Various accessibility apps available on smartphones further enhance users’ independence. For example, apps offering real-time speech-to-text transcription support people with hearing impairments, while navigation apps designed for wheelchair users improve mobility and participation in daily activities. The combination of hardware and software upgrades ensures smartphones remain at the forefront of the UK digital society’s push toward inclusivity.

Comparing Smartphones and Traditional Computing Models

Smartphones versus traditional computing devices like desktops and laptops reveal distinct differences in performance, portability, and user experience, especially within the UK. While desktops often outperform smartphones in raw computing power, modern smartphones excel in portability and convenience. Users benefit from quick access to apps and communications on the go, reshaping how technology fits daily life.

In terms of cost, smartphones generally present a lower entry price compared to desktops and laptops. However, their scalability can be limited; hardware upgrades are less feasible, unlike traditional computers which can be customized or expanded over time. From a sustainability perspective, smartphones’ shorter lifecycle raises concerns, yet advancements in recycling and energy-efficient manufacturing are increasingly addressing these challenges.
